Lyophilization Equipment & Services Market Analysis

The lyophilization equipment and services market is poised to grow at a CAGR of 8.5% during the forecast period.

The impact of COVID-19 in its initial phase was profound owing to restrictions on drug production in pharmaceutical and biotech manufacturing sites, which hampered market growth. The demand for lyophilized drugs and emergency use authorization (EUA) for certain lyophilized drugs compensated for the market growth in the later stages of the pandemic. For instance, in May 2020, Cipla launched remdesivir under its brand name CIPREMI (remdesivir lyophilized powder for injection, 100 mg). Gilead Sciences Inc. received a EUA from the US FDA to use remdesivir for COVID-19 patients who were hospitalized. The market has been recovering well over the last two years since the drug manufacturing restrictions were lifted. The growing demand and approvals for lyophilized drugs are ultimately propelling the use of lyophilization equipment and services and are hence expected to propel the market during the forecast period.

The key drivers augmenting the market are the rising demand for lyophilized products in the pharmaceutical industry and technological advancements in lyophilization methods.

In the past few years, the number of biopharmaceuticals being developed and manufactured has increased significantly. Moreover, the rising demand for aseptic packaging and preservation, as well as the increase in the production of protein-based drugs, is expected to boost the demand for freeze-drying. Thus, pharmaceutical manufacturers and equipment suppliers are moving toward an array of advanced process analytical technologies (PAT) to help optimize their freeze-drying operations. In the case of biologics, the formulation and storage in aqueous solutions result in instability. Lyophilization can help improve their long-term stability. The process of lyophilization is a complex, multistep process that requires a sound understanding of both the product and the process-related attributes to ensure higher operational efficiency and consistency in producing acceptable final products. As most pharmaceutical products could not be commercially viable without lyophilization, their usage is inevitable.

Furthermore, growth in the number of commercially available vaccines and injectables for various disease conditions and rising demand for contract manufacturing and outsourcing activities in the biopharmaceutical industry are also anticipated to emphasize the growth of the global lyophilization equipment and services market in the near future.

The advancements in technology and increasing product approvals, along with partnerships and collaborations by key players, are helping in the market's growth. For instance, in September 2021, DARA Pharma Group and MOTUS signed a technology transfer agreement to manufacture loading systems for freeze dryers. Moreover, in December 2021, PCI Pharma Services (PCI), a CDMO, reported the closing of the earlier-notified acquisition of Lyophilization Services of New England, Inc., a CDMO based in Bedford, New Hampshire. This addition is a critical step for PCI, as LSNE will extend PCI's range of services as a global CDMO, creating its expertise in the clinical trial supply, specialty manufacturing, and pharmaceutical packaging. PCI can now offer integrated large and small-molecule solutions for its clinical and commercial consumers, including global manufacturing capabilities in high potency, complex formulations, sterile fill-finish, and lyophilization, an important manufacturing process commonly used with injectable and biologic therapies. Such partnerships are projected to boost market growth during the forecast period.

Therefore, owing to the aforementioned factors, it is anticipated that the studied market will witness growth over the analysis period. However, the high setup and maintenance costs of freeze-drying equipment and the increasing utilization of alternative drying techniques in the pharmaceutical and biotechnology industries are likely to impede the market growth.
